Kofi Adams playing double standard - Joshua Alabi

Former Vice Chancellor of the University of Professional Studies Accra, (UPSA) and a Flag bearer aspirant of the National Democratic Congress (NDC), Professor Joshua Alabi has stated that, he is under threat by the party's National Organiser, Kofi Adams.

He stated on Accra based radio station Class FM earlier today that, Kofi Adams is playing a double standard as he is inciting some supporters of the party who are chasing him with cutlasses among other weapons.

Professor Alabi further added that, Kofi Adams had declared that Former President John Mahama will be running for the flag bearership position.

“Kofi Adams came out openly to tell the world that former President Mahama should lead the party. What was he [Mr Adams] doing?" he said.

He also said that, Kofi Adams has accused him and others, saying they were not focused on the unity of the party but rather fighting for their personal ambitions.

He said, “Kofi Adams met me in one of the constituencies in Krowor, [it was] reorganisation. That day I didn’t speak, I financed the whole programme there, yes, and he came and he got the opportunity to talk but I didn’t talk, I didn’t campaign, he met me there. We went round… to listen to the problems of the constituency and see how best we could bring the warring factions together… While he was campaigning for somebody, he has asked people in other constituencies to take cutlasses and chase us out when we come in.

This is the party that we have; these are the executives that we have. If we want the party to progress the way we want it to progress let’s do things properly”.
